Patras vs Caravelas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Patras, Greece and Caravelas, Brazil is approximately 8,892 km or 5,525 mi.
  • To reach Patras in this distance one would set out from Caravelas bearing 44.2°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Patras bearing 57.8° or ENE .
  • Patras has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Caravelas has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
  • Patras is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ome whereas Caravelas is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 6.6 °C (11.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 12.4 °C (22.3°F) more in Patras.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 710.3 mm (28 in) less which is equivalent to 710.3 l/m² (17.43 US gal/ft²) or 7,103,000 l/ha (759,358 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 17.8° lower in Patras than in Caravelas.
  • Relative humidity levels are 15.7%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 9.8°C (17.6°F) lower.
